Ghana’s National Service Authority and Ohio University forge strategic partnership

NSA partners Ohio University to boost workforce readiness and digital skills among Ghanaian graduate Ghana’s National Service Authority (NSA) has taken a significant step toward transforming National Service into a stronger bridge between higher education and the world of work, following the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ding with Ohio University in the United States.
